CyberPanel Installation: A Step-by-Step Guide
Getting a CyberPanel implementation is relatively straightforward, even with beginners. This short guide will walk you across the necessary steps. First, confirm your system meets the minimum specifications – a clean Ubuntu 22.04 is typically recommended. Next, obtain the latest CyberPanel utility using the official website. Then, execute the process via the command line – just paste the given command into your shell and hit Enter. The automatic sequence will subsequently deal with the rest. Finally, visit your created CyberPanel control panel through the specified link and begin creating your sites.

CyberPanel Install: Troubleshooting Common Issues
Encountering setbacks during your CyberPanel installation ? It's fairly common to hit some hurdles . Often, flawed DNS configurations are the main culprit, preventing successful domain confirmation. Make positive your nameservers are accurately pointing to CyberPanel’s assigned servers. Additionally, access problems can frequently arise, especially if your platform user lacks the necessary rights . Finally, check your server resources , as limited RAM or disk space can disrupt the entire activity. Reviewing the CyberPanel guide and browsing the communities are great ways to find solutions to these frequent obstacles .

CyberPanel Install: Choosing the Right Server
Selecting the ideal host for your CyberPanel setup is critical for optimal functionality. Consider several elements – primarily the size of capacity needed. A base of 4GB of memory is suggested for a simple CyberPanel installation, but bigger websites or those foreseeing large traffic volumes will gain 8GB or even 16GB. In terms of CPU, a recent multi-core is adequate for many uses. Lastly , check your server utilizes reliable hardware and offers a supported operating system , like Ubuntu .
